Ingredients
  

1 cup cream cheese, softened

1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ese

1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ese

6 cloves of garlic, roasted

1/4 cup sour cream

2 tablespoons olive oil

1/2 teaspoon dried thyme

Salt and pepper to taste

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)

Instructions
 

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).

    Roast the garlic: Wrap the cloves of garlic in aluminum foil with a drizzle of olive oil and a sprinkle of salt. Bake in the preheated oven for about 20-25 minutes, until tender and caramelized. Allow to cool slightly.

      In a mixing bowl, combine the softened cream cheese, shredded mozzarella, grated Parmesan, sour cream, and dried thyme.

        Squeeze the roasted garlic out of its skins and mash it into a paste. Add this to the cheese mixture and season with salt and pepper. Stir until everything is well combined.

          Transfer the mixture into a baking dish. Drizzle with a little olive oil on top for added flavor and a nice crust.

            Bake in the oven for 25-30 minutes or until the dip is hot and bubbly with a golden top.

              Remove from oven, let it cool for a few minutes, and then garnish with fresh parsley.

                Serve warm with sliced baguette, pita chips, or fresh vegetable sticks.

                  Prep Time: 10 minutes | Total Time: 40 minutes | Servings: 4-6
